Finally out! We found that mRNAs are not uniformly distributed across the cytoplasm. mRNA architecture is the strongest determinant for localization. Subcytoplasmic location of translation controls protein output. cell.com/molecular-cell…

🚨New lab preprint: "We therefore propose a model for cytoskeletal evolution in which pools of microtubule network components constrain and guide the diversification of the entire network, so that the evolution of tubulin is inextricably linked to that of its binding partners."
